How can you write a blog post with good SEO?

We need to know how we can write a good blog post with SEO

To write a blog post with good SEO, follow these steps:

Keyword-rich topic:

When choosing a topic, think about what your target audience is searching for and what keywords they might use. Tools like Google Keyword Planner can help you find keywords with high search volume and low competition.

Title Optimization:

Your title should be clear, concise and include your desired keywords. Aim for a title that is no longer than 60 characters, as this is the maximum length that will appear in most search engine results pages (SERPs).

Headings and subheadings:

 Headings and subheadings help break up your content into smaller, more manageable chunks, making it easier for both users and search engines to understand the structure of your content. Use H1 tags for the main heading of your post, H2 tags for subheadings, and H3 tags for subheadings.

Adding keywords:

Use your desired keywords in the first 100 words of your content, as well as in your subheadings, meta descriptions, and image alt tags. However, be careful not to overuse your keywords, as this is known as "keyword stuffing" and can result in penalties from search engines.

High-quality content: 

Writeinformative, well-researched content that is of value to your target audience. The more users spend on your site, the more search engines will recognize the value of your content, which can positively impact your search engine rankings.

Image Optimization: 

Optimize your images by using descriptive file names and ALT tags. Make sure your images are also compressed to ensure fast loading times, which can positively impact user experience and your search engine rankings.

Internal and External Links:

Linking to other relevant blog posts on your site, as well as high-quality external sources, helps improve user experience and establish your site as a credible authority in your niche. can be found

Meta Descriptions:

Write a clear and concise meta description that summarizes your post and includes your desired keyword. Meta descriptions should not exceed 155 characters and accurately reflect the content of your blog post.

Error checking:

Before publishing your blog post, be sure to check for spelling and grammar errors, as well as broken links. A well-written, error-free post can help establish your site as a credible authority and improve user experience.

Promotion: 

Share your post on social media, email it to your subscribers, and engage with comments on your post to increase visibility and drive traffic to your site.


These tips can help you create blog posts with good SEO, but keep in mind that SEO is a long-term strategy, and the results of your efforts may not be immediate. Consistently creating high-quality, optimized content and promoting your site through various channels can help improve your search engine rankings over time.

Sure, here are some more tips to improve your blog post's SEO: 

Make sure your website is mobile-friendly: 

A large number of internet users access websites on their mobile devices, so it's important to make sure your website is mobile-friendly.

Use social media to promote your post:

Share your post on your social media channels to increase visibility and drive traffic to your site.

Use Schema Markup: 

Schema markup helps search engines understand the context of your content and can improve your website's appearance in search results. 

Encourage engagement: 

Encourage engagement through comments, social shares, and other forms of interaction to increase the visibility and credibility of your blog post.

Monitor your analytics:

Use tools like Google Analytics to monitor your blog post performance, including the number of visits, average time spent on your site, and your traffic sources.

Keep your website up-to-date: 

Update your website regularly with fresh, high-quality content to keep visitors engaged and improve your website's search engine rankings.

Use long-tail keywords:

Long-tail keywords are more specific and less competitive than short, general keywords, and can help you rank for a more targeted audience.

Write for humans, not search engines:

While optimizing your blog post for search engines is important, remember to write for your target audience first. The best SEO strategy is to create high-quality, informative content that is valuable to your readers.